
Apple unveiled its latest iPhone lineup and new smartwatches at its annual product launch, a strategic move aimed at fending off increasing competition. This product push, however, occurs as the tech giant faces growing concerns about its lagging position in the rapidly evolving generative AI space.

(AAPL) is executing its annual hardware refresh with the launch of a new iPhone lineup and smartwatches, a strategic move explicitly aimed at defending its market position against rising competition. This product cycle is critical for sustaining the company's ecosystem and revenue streams. However, the launch is overshadowed by a significant strategic concern highlighted in the market: Apple's perceived lag in the generative AI sector.
